Create Something Amazing lands No. 632 on Inc. 5000
Create Something Amazing ranked No. 632 on the 2026 Inc. 5000 after posting 541% three-year revenue growth. The Los Angeles event strategy and production agency says the recognition highlights its expansion since 2022 and its focus on women in production leadership.
Why it matters: - Create Something Amazing’s Inc. 5000 ranking signals fast growth in a competitive private-company landscape. - The honor can help the Los Angeles agency build credibility with enterprise clients, vendors and future hires. - The company’s 541% three-year revenue growth stands out in a list where the median growth rate was 130%.
What happened: - Create Something Amazing was ranked No. 632 on the 2026 Inc. 5000 list of America’s fastest-growing private companies. - The company is headquartered in Los Angeles and was founded in 2022. - Create Something Amazing said the ranking reflects 541% three-year revenue growth. - Founder and Executive Producer Diana Sabb said the company started to create more leadership opportunities for women in the production industry.
The details: - Create Something Amazing is a women-owned event strategy, production and creative agency. - The agency produces conferences, executive summits, leadership experiences, brand activations, curated dinners and private events. - The company works with clients in technology, finance, beauty, healthcare, sports, fashion and consumer brands. - Create Something Amazing says it operates globally and has produced experiences in markets including China and London. - The agency says it combines strategy, creative direction, operational excellence and execution for clients. - Sabb said the company’s growth goes beyond event production and is about creating opportunities, building careers and solving complex problems. - Sabb said the recognition belongs to the team, clients and vendor partners that support the business. - Inc. said the 2026 list includes companies across AI, advanced manufacturing, healthcare, consumer products and professional services. - Inc. said the 5,000 companies on the list added more than 627,208 jobs to the U.S. economy over the past three years. - Inc. said the median three-year revenue growth rate among honorees was 130%. - The full list and company profiles are available at Inc. 5000. - Inc. will honor the companies at the 2026 Inc. 5000 Conference & Gala Oct. 14-16 in Dallas, Texas. - The top 500 companies will appear in the fall issue of Inc. Magazine.
